Aries and Gemini Compatibility – Love & Relationship
When Aries and Gemini come together, the connection feels immediate and alive. Both signs move fast, think fast, and act without overthinking. Aries brings energy. Gemini brings variety. What forms between them is not calm, it’s kinetic.
This pairing starts with curiosity. Aries wants a challenge. Gemini wants stimulation. They meet in motion, drawn to each other’s pace and unpredictability. There’s no need for long explanations. They connect through ideas, actions, and momentum.
But their differences are just beneath the surface. Aries acts on instinct. Gemini shifts with thought. Aries wants to lead. Gemini prefers to explore. This doesn’t always lead to conflict, but it requires understanding. If they try to control each other, the connection weakens. If they stay flexible, it becomes a partnership built on movement, not pressure.

Aries and Gemini Love Compatibility
Love between Aries and Gemini often begins before either realizes what’s happening. There’s a shared tempo in how they move through the world—fast, responsive, and alert. Aries leads with boldness. Gemini responds with wit. Together, they create a dynamic that feels spontaneous but also strangely aligned.
The bond builds on interaction. Aries wants intensity. Gemini wants conversation. What they share is a desire to stay interested. This isn’t a pairing that relies on emotional stillness or long-term planning in the beginning. It’s fueled by shared discovery. A sudden trip. A new idea. A challenge accepted without warning.
But love needs more than momentum. Aries may become impatient when Gemini shifts focus too often. Gemini may feel confined when Aries pushes for clear direction. The challenge isn’t in caring. It’s in keeping pace without pulling apart. If they allow each other to evolve within the relationship instead of locking into a fixed rhythm, love becomes more than exciting. It becomes sustainable.

Aries and Gemini Communication & Interest Compatibility
Aries and Gemini communicate in motion. Neither waits long before speaking. Both enjoy sharing ideas, reacting to change, and moving fast through conversations. But similar speed doesn’t always mean similar goals. What connects them at first may create friction later if expectations shift without warning.
Communication
Aries speaks to act. Gemini speaks to explore. Aries often wants decisions. Gemini often wants discussion. In conversation, Aries may push for conclusions. Gemini may shift from topic to topic, following thought rather than outcome.
For example, Aries might say, “Let’s do it,” expecting quick agreement. Gemini might respond with a new question, not because they disagree, but because they’re still gathering options. Aries sees delay. Gemini sees discovery. These differences don’t break the connection, but they require awareness. Aries benefits from patience. Gemini benefits from clarity.
Their best communication happens when Aries listens before moving forward, and Gemini anchors their ideas with intention. It’s not about talking more. It’s about recognizing what the other is trying to do with their words.
Interests
They rarely sit still. Aries wants challenge and progress. Gemini wants variety and stimulation. What excites both is movement, whether it’s a change in scenery, topic, or plan. But the way they approach activity can differ.
Imagine Aries planning a goal-oriented weekend with hiking, timing, and measurable results. Gemini may suggest changing the route midway to follow a random trail or stop at a café. Aries could see that as a distraction. Gemini sees it as making the moment more meaningful. Conflict happens when one insists on outcome and the other on process.
They thrive when plans have structure with room for adjustment. Aries can set direction. Gemini can shift the tone. Together, they turn everyday experiences into something memorable, not because everything went as planned, but because they stayed connected throughout.
Possible Problems and Difficulties
Aries and Gemini connect through speed, but that same pace can become a source of tension. What starts as excitement may turn into impatience if one partner begins to expect more structure than the other is ready to offer.
Aries often seeks clarity. Gemini prefers options. Aries may ask direct questions to understand where things are heading. Gemini may respond with possibilities rather than commitments. Aries can interpret this as avoidance. Gemini may feel cornered by expectations. Neither means harm. Their styles just follow different logic.
Another point of tension is consistency. Aries wants to keep momentum. Gemini wants to keep it interesting. If Aries sets a plan and Gemini shifts direction halfway through, frustration builds. If Gemini suggests a new idea and Aries dismisses it too quickly, curiosity turns into distance.
They may also struggle with focus. Aries likes goals that can be reached. Gemini enjoys ideas that unfold over time. Without effort, they begin moving in separate directions without realizing it. Not because they stopped caring, but because they stopped checking in.
What creates difficulty here is not lack of interest. It’s the assumption that the connection will run on autopilot. For this relationship to grow, both signs must slow down enough to stay aware of each other’s pace and purpose.
